What Features Make a Stainless Steel Utility Sink the Best Choice?

The best stainless steel utility sinks are defined by several important features that enhance their functionality and durability.

  • Corrosion Resistance: Stainless steel is inherently resistant to rust and corrosion, making it ideal for utility sinks that are often exposed to water and harsh cleaning agents. This characteristic ensures a long lifespan and maintains the sink’s appearance over time.
  • Durability: Stainless steel utility sinks are built to withstand heavy use and can handle impacts without denting or chipping. Their robust construction makes them suitable for both residential and commercial environments, where they may be subjected to rigorous conditions.
  • Easy to Clean: The smooth, non-porous surface of stainless steel makes cleaning a breeze, as it does not harbor bacteria or grime. This feature is particularly important for utility sinks used in kitchens or laundry areas, where hygiene is a priority.
  • Stylish Appearance: Stainless steel provides a sleek and modern look that can complement various décor styles. Its reflective surface can brighten up spaces, making it not only functional but also visually appealing.
  • Heat Resistance: Stainless steel can withstand high temperatures, allowing it to be used for hot water tasks without damaging the material. This feature is beneficial for utility sinks that may be used for washing pots, pans, or other items that require hot water.
  • Variety of Sizes and Configurations: Stainless steel utility sinks come in a range of sizes and configurations, including single and double basins, which cater to different space requirements and user preferences. This versatility allows for customized installations that fit various utility needs.
  • Affordability: While high-end models exist, many stainless steel utility sinks are available at competitive prices, making them an economical choice for homeowners and businesses alike. Their durability and low maintenance costs further enhance their cost-effectiveness over time.

What Dimensions Are Best for Utility and Functionality in a Sink?

The best dimensions for utility and functionality in a sink depend on various factors including space, usage, and personal preference.

  • Depth: A depth of 10 to 12 inches is ideal for utility sinks, as it allows for soaking larger items and prevents water from splashing out during use.
  • Width: A width of 24 to 30 inches provides ample space for washing larger tools or equipment while still fitting comfortably in most laundry or utility areas.
  • Length: A length of 36 to 48 inches is recommended for multi-tasking, allowing enough room for multiple users or various tasks without feeling cramped.
  • Height: Standard height is typically around 36 inches, but adjustable or custom heights can enhance ergonomics for different users, making it easier to work without straining.

The depth of a utility sink is crucial for functionality; a deeper sink can accommodate larger items and reduce mess. A width that balances space and convenience ensures that you can clean various tools or items without difficulty. Length is essential for accommodating multiple users or tasks, while an appropriate height enhances comfort during use.

What Price Range Can You Expect for Quality Steel Utility Sinks?

The price range for quality stainless steel utility sinks can vary significantly based on size, brand, and features.

  • Basic Models: Typically priced between $150 and $300, these sinks are often single-basin designs with minimal features.
  • Mid-Range Options: Ranging from $300 to $600, these sinks may include additional features such as double basins, thicker gauge stainless steel, and better soundproofing.
  • High-End Sinks: These models can start from $600 and go upwards to $1,200 or more, offering premium finishes, advanced design features, and larger sizes suitable for commercial use.
  • Custom or Specialty Sinks: Prices for custom designs can exceed $1,200, depending on the specifications and additional features such as integrated drainboards or custom dimensions.

Basic models are often sufficient for light household use and can be a great value for someone looking to add functionality without breaking the bank. Mid-range options typically offer improved durability and features, making them a popular choice for those who need a reliable sink for heavier tasks. High-end sinks are ideal for professionals or serious DIY enthusiasts who require maximum durability and functionality, often featuring thicker steel and sophisticated design elements. Custom or specialty sinks cater to specific needs and can be tailored to fit unique spaces, but they come at a premium price due to their bespoke nature.

How Should You Properly Maintain a Stainless Steel Utility Sink?

To properly maintain a stainless steel utility sink, consider the following practices:

  • Regular Cleaning: Clean the sink regularly using a mild detergent and warm water to remove dirt and grime.
  • Avoid Harsh Chemicals: Refrain from using abrasive cleaners or harsh chemicals that can scratch or damage the surface of the sink.
  • Dry After Use: Always dry the sink with a soft cloth after use to prevent water spots and mineral deposits from forming.
  • Use a Protective Coating: Consider applying a protective coating or stainless steel polish periodically to enhance shine and provide a barrier against stains.
  • Inspect for Damage: Regularly inspect the sink for any scratches, dents, or rust spots that may need attention or repair.

Regular cleaning is essential as it helps maintain the sink’s appearance and prevents buildup of stains or bacteria. Using mild detergent and warm water is effective and safe for the stainless steel surface.

Avoid harsh chemicals that can cause scratches or discoloration. Opt for gentle, non-abrasive cleaners to preserve the integrity of the sink’s finish.

Drying the sink after each use is a simple but effective way to prevent water spots and mineral deposits that can dull the shine of stainless steel.

Applying a protective coating or stainless steel polish can enhance the sink’s luster and create a barrier against potential stains, making it easier to clean in the future.

Lastly, regularly inspecting the sink for damage allows you to address issues such as scratches or rust promptly, ensuring the sink remains functional and visually appealing over time.
